8. Security incidents (Florida)

If we determine that a breach of personal information has occurred, we will investigate and notify affected Florida residents in accordance with Florida Statutes §501.171, including notice without unreasonable delay and no later than 30 days after that determination, unless a law-enforcement delay is authorized. Notice will describe the incident in general terms, the types of information involved to the extent known, protective steps we are taking, and how to reach us at support@claimsaverplus.com. We may also notify the Florida Department of Legal Affairs as that statute requires.
